17 Nov., 1949 - The Enterprise - Cora (Beales) McDonald

MRS. C. McDONALD RITES NOV. 18

Mrs. Cora McDonald, descendant of pioneer family, died Tuesday noon at the Dodge County hospital. She had been ill for the past four months and had been in the hospital for the past four weeks.

Deceased was born in Washington County on Dec. 12, 1878, and most of her life was spent in and around Ft. Calhoun. Her parents were early pioneers and she knew the early history and the manner of the life of the pioneer.

On December 29th, 1907 she was married to Wm. McDonald, and they farmed near Calhoun until the death of her husband. She leaves two daughters, Mrs. Dorothy Brandert of Fremont and Mrs. Florence Aronson of Tekamah and two sons, Donald of Wayzota, Minn. and Laurel of Scottsbluff.

She also leaves two brothers, Austin Beales of Blair and Wm. of Omaha and two sisters, Jessie McDonald of Kennard and Marie Gates of Papillion, Nebraska and eleven grandchildren and two great grandchildren.

Funeral services will be held at 1:30 pm. Friday in the Trinity Lutheran church in Fremont, and interment will be made at about 3:00 pm. in the Calhoun cemetery.
